Elizabeth Mounter Doctoral Scholarship in Nutrition
Brief Description
The Elizabeth Mounter Doctoral Scholarship in Nutrition is a highly competitive program that aims to support outstanding doctoral students in the field of Nutrition. The scholarship is awarded annually to students who exhibit strong academic potential and a commitment to contributing to the field of Nutrition through their research.
Host Institution(s)
The scholarship is hosted by The University of Guelph, a renowned Canadian university known for its excellence in research and education in the field of Nutrition. The university offers state-of-the-art facilities and a supportive learning environment for students to thrive in their academic pursuits.
Level/Field of Study
The scholarship is open to students pursuing a PhD in Nutrition. This program is designed for students who have completed their Master’s degree and are ready to embark on independent research in their field of interest.
Number of Awards
One scholarship is awarded annually to an exceptional doctoral student.
Target Group
The Elizabeth Mounter Doctoral Scholarship in Nutrition is open to both domestic and international students. All students who meet the eligibility criteria are encouraged to apply.
Scholarship Value/Inclusions
The scholarship covers full tuition fees for the duration of the student’s doctoral program. In addition, the recipient will receive a generous living allowance to cover their living expenses and research costs.
Eligibility Criteria
To be eligible for the scholarship,
- Applicants must have a strong academic record, with a minimum GPA of 3.7 in their previous studies.
- They must also hold a Master’s degree in Nutrition or a related field.
- Applicants are also required to submit a research proposal that aligns with the university’s research priorities in the field of Nutrition.
- Additional eligibility criteria may apply, depending on the specific program.

Application Instructions
Interested students are required to submit an application to The University of Guelph’s Graduate Studies office. The application must include a research proposal, along with all academic transcripts, letters of recommendation, and other supporting documents. It is important to note that the application deadline varies each year, so applicants are advised to check the official website for the most up-to-date information.
